DADS released four information letters: Screen 573 allows ICFs/MR to monitor compliance with RLO. The screen's new function is to identify individuals in each queried component code that have not received a RLO due to being a new admission. These individuals will show as "Not Found" on Screen 573. A vendor will place a hold on payments to facilities until all reviews are updated and completed. DADS released one provider and two information letters: Some ICFs/MR providers have been confused about when to report and investigate suspected client abuse, neglect or exploitation (A/N/E). Continue to report incidents to DADS until June 1, 2010, at which time the Department of Family and Protective Services will take over. Provider and Information Letters: ICFs/MR, HSC, TxHml
According to the code, the examining physician determines the severity of injuries in ICF/MR facilities. In a provider letter, DADS informed ICFs/MR that an examining PA and APN may also determine severity of injuries if delegated by an examining physician. Download the letter here. DADS is removing the cost limitation for Augmentative Communication Devices (ACDs) for residents in the DADS ICF/MR program.
